Described as "a more hardcore Battlefield" in 2018, in June 2020 the developer The Farm 51 planned a revamp and relaunch together with the publisher My.Games and co-publisher The 4 Winds Entertainment joined in 2021; in 2021 the game seemed to be moving away from the "hardcore". The developer commented that World War 3 aims for as much realism as possible without compromising gameplay: "One of our goals with World War 3 is to offer realistic simulations with an altogether enjoyable experience. We call this playable realism." The game features "an advanced ballistics system, full-body awareness, vehicle physics, and extensive customization.
It is foremost a strong emphasis on team cooperation within the national military forces, full body awareness, and extensive, versatile customization. Paired with an advanced ballistics system, authentic armor system, or life-like weaponry, by playing WW3 you can get hold of an impression of authenticity and truly make your mark on the battlefield.

I also have to note that Scott Pilgrim vs. The World: The Game is the most prominent video game ever to be set in my hometown of Toronto, so it holds a special place personally. I can’t think of another game where you have to dodge TTC buses or collect toonies ($2 coins) to buy a poutine. My friends from New York, London, and Tokyo can play through huge, nearly photo-realistic versions of their homes, but I’m pretty happy to stick with what Scott Pilgrim has to offer. It’s certainly very Canadian.
Unlike a standard beat 'em up game, Scott Pilgrim vs. The World: The Game requires more than skill and luck for you to see the end credits. You’ll need to purchase stat-boosting items from stores scattered through each stage. Snacks replenish health, while clothing and accessories provide added defense. Meals, such as sushi or steak, permanently boost your strength and agility. Defeated enemies drop coins that you use to purchase those items.

The Organiser Agreement for TWG 2025 was signed by the Mayor of Chengdu, Mr Luo Qiang in 2019, in Gold Coast, Australia. The Vice President of IOC and the Chinese Olympic Committee, Mr Yu Zaiqing, signed the agreement as Witness. IWGA President José Perurena signed on behalf of the International World Games Association. This was preceded by ratification of the contract by the then 37 (now 40) member federations of the IWGA during the Annual General Meeting in 2019.
